SWAY

Nestled on the southern edge of the New Forest National Park, the village of Sway in Hampshire is a quintessential English getaway.

Combining rugged natural beauty with a rich Victorian heritage, it offers a peaceful retreat for those looking to escape the bustle of city life while remaining well-connected to London and the South Coast.

Gateway to the New Forest

Sway is an ideal base for outdoor enthusiasts. The village is surrounded by ancient woodland and open heaths where the famous New Forest ponies roam free.

  • Walking & Cycling: Numerous trails lead directly from the village into the heart of the forest. The nearby Wilverley Plain and Setthorns offer some of the best gravel tracks for cycling and scenic dog-walking routes.

  • Horse Riding: For a unique perspective, visit local stables like Brockenhurst Riding Stables to explore the park on horseback.

Nearby Places of Interest

Sway’s location is ideal for visiting some of Hampshire's top attractions:

  • Just 400 m from the protected area of The New Forest and the free roaming animals.

  • Lymington (4 miles): A beautiful Georgian market town and sailing resort.

Don't miss the St Barbe Museum and Gallery for local history.

  • Beaulieu (7 miles): Home to the world-famous National Motor Museum and the historic Palace House.

  • Milford on Sea (5 miles): Visit the pebbled beaches and the historic Hurst Castle, an artillery fortress built by Henry VIII.
